    In light of the recent events in our economy, today I want to highlight some of the expert guidance I’ve found for those of us involved in Holiday online selling and marketing! Based on what I have researched and read, my perspective is two-fold right now:

    1. Lower expectations – everyone from large publicly-traded companies to online marketing experts in the blogosphere have been lowering their expectations for Q4 of this year. Even our friends at the National Retail Federation have recently lowered their Holiday Season forecast to an over-all Holiday Sales gain of just 2.2 percent, that is the slowest growth-rate since 2002. So - focusing creatively on spending strategies is key right now! But this doesn’t mean stopping all spending on advertising, it means to pay more attention to being strategic!
